A Historic Moment for Bollywood’s Spy Universe
Directed by Shiv Rawail, who earned widespread acclaim for The Railway Men, Alpha stars Alia Bhatt and Sharvari in the lead roles, supported by Bobby Deol and R. Madhavan. The film is being hailed as a landmark production — the first female-led spy thriller within the prestigious YRF Spy Universe franchise.
Reports indicate that Alia Bhatt commanded a fee of approximately ₹17 crore for the film, underscoring the studio’s massive confidence in her box office pull. Bobby Deol and R. Madhavan reportedly received around ₹6 crore each.
The ₹12 Crore Box Office Target on Day 1
Industry analysts are closely watching whether Alpha can register a double-digit opening on its first day. To make history and enter the Top 10 spy thriller openers in Hindi cinema, the film needs to collect a minimum of ₹12 crore net at the domestic box office.
What Does the 10th Spot Look Like?
The benchmark is set by Akshay Kumar and Sonakshi Sinha’s Holiday: A Soldier Is Never Off Duty (2014), which opened to approximately ₹12 crore on its debut day — currently holding the 10th position among spy thriller openers in India.
